After using it heavily, I found that the zoom and focus rings are a bit more fluid. Which makes shooting it even easier. It did seem a bit heavier for some reason but maybe that is because I havent shot in a few days. I am not saying it is heavy, but i havent shot with a 70-200 in about a month now. Another thing to note is that the focus was quick and responsive. IS is very very quiet compared to my mk I. Sharpness is sharper wide open and it seemed better paired on my mkIIn than my mk I was when I had it on there. (I always had my mk I on my 1dmkIIn so i felt like that would be a good test). overall, I recommend as an upgrade to the mk I.
